YouTube-DL este un Windows, Mac OS, precum și instrumentul GNU/Linux care face descărcarea videoclipurilor web destul de ușoare. Acesta implementează un motor de descărcare puternic, precum și poate descărca, precum și manipularea audio, precum și date video de pe o serie de site -uri web. După cum sugerează și numele său, a început inițial ca un instrument pentru a descărca videoclipuri YouTube pe Android folosind comenzi YouTube-DL, cu toate acestea, ulterior a fost lărgit de cartier pentru a susține mult mai mult de o sută de site-uri web diferite. Este open source, cu dimensiuni reduse, precum și permite descărcarea suportului cu o singură comandă.
Între altele, comenzile „YouTube-DL” acceptă descărcarea de la respectarea serviciilor:
YouTube
ADN – Anime Digital Network
Audiomack
BBC
Dailymotion
Descoperire
Play.fm
TIC nervos
Vimeo
O listă a tuturor site -urilor web acceptate poate fi descoperită aici.
Datorită activității comunității open source, este posibil să rulați YouTube-DL pe Android cu Termux. Atunci când sunt instalate, toate operațiunile sale vor fi acceptate în totalitate pe dispozitivul Android, inclusiv extragerea audio din datele video (de exemplu, clipuri video, concerte online), precum și selectarea fluxurilor de descărcare între diferite audio, precum și stiluri video oferite pe site-ul.
Cum să -l configurați
Instalați Termux
Instalați pluginul Termux: API. Termux are nevoie de acest plugin pentru a obține acces la stocarea dispozitivului Android.
Activați accesul la stocare la termux. Deschideți aplicația Termux, precum și accesați comanda respectă cu:
TERMUX-SETUP-STORAGE
Gadgetul dvs. poate arunca un dialog care solicită accesul la stocare la autorizare pentru aplicația Termux.
Instalați pachetele necesare
În interiorul termuxului, accesați comanda respectă cu:
PKG SET -UP -Y FFMPEG PYTHON
Aceasta va configura Python, precum și dependențe FFMPEG. În continuare, configurați YouTube-DL cu comanda respectă cu:
pip a configurat YouTube-dl
Trebuie să citești: Cum se convertește datele media utilizând FFMPEG, precum și Termux
Cum să utilizați YouTube-DL pentru a descărca videoclipuri YouTube
YouTube-DL permite manipularea completă a media utilizând o singură comandă. Putem iniția o descărcare de bază cu comanda respectă cu:
YouTube-DL Media_url
Unde media_url este adresa URL a fișierului media. De exemplu, pentru a descărca trailerul ficțiunii Pulp Picture de pe YouTube, am problema această comandă:
YouTube-dl
YouTube-DL va extrage imediat informațiile paginii web, precum și va descărca fișierul media. Pe versiunile actuale, YouTube-DL descarcă imediat videoclipuri, precum și fluxuri audio de cele mai bune calitate oferite de înaltă calitate atunci când nu se transmit alegeri suplimentare.
Selecția de videoclipuri, precum și format audio
YouTube-DL furnizează diferite opțiuni de configurare pentru formatul video descărcat. În primul rând, trecerea parametrului -f va ecraniza toate stilurile oferite pentru descărcare:
YouTube -dl -f
Aceasta va furniza o ieșire ca următoarele:
Comenzi YouTube-DL
Editorii aleg: Temele întunecate, precum și imaginile de fundal negre economisesc bateria?
Prima coloană ecranizează codul de stil, a doua coloană extensia media, precum și a treia rezoluție (pentru fluxuri video). În sensul că avem nevoie să descărcăm cel mai bun flux video oferit (ultimul), precum și fluxul audio Opus 160K, trebuie să oferim comanda respectă:
YouTube -dl -f 22+251
În cazul în care parametrul -f instruiește YouTube -DL să aleagă codurile de stil 22, precum și 251, care reprezintă videoclipul, precum și, respectiv, fluxul audio.
Selecție bazată pe condiții
YouTube-DL furnizează o performanță fascinantă pentru persoanele care necesită un control mai mare. video, precum și audio pot fi filtrate punând o condiție între paranteze, ca în -f „[înălțime = 720]” (selectează, precum și descărcă un videoclip cu înălțime de 720 pixeli) sau -f „[FileSize> 10m]” (selectează, precum și descărcări media cu dimensiunea datelor mai mare de 10 MB). Câmpurile care pot fi utilizate în condiții sunt următoarele:
FileSize: numărul de octeți, dacă este înțeles în avans
Lățime: lățimea videoclipului, dacă este cunoscut
Înălțime: înălțimea videoclipului, dacă este cunoscut
TBR: rata tipică de biți a audio, precum și video în KBIT/S
ABR: rată de biți audio tipică în kbit/s
VBR: rată video tipică de biți în KBIT/S
ASR: Rata de eșantionare audio în Hertz
FPS: rata cadrului
Așadar, comanda respectivă ar alege, precum și descărcarea datelor video cu rate de cadru mai mari de 25, înălțimea mai mare sau egală cu 720 pixeli, precum și o rată de eșantionare audio mai mare de 44200 Hz:
youtube -dl -f “[fps> 25] [înălțime> = 720] [ASR> 44200]” Media_url
Dacă fluxurile audio/video oferite nu acoperă criteriile furnizate, YouTube-DL va ecraniza un mesaj de eroare, precum și ieșirea. Filtrarea Utilizarea condiționărilor poate fi benefică pentru dispozitivele Android mai vechi, care nu pot decoda rapid datele video cu rezoluții ridicate.
Extragerea, precum și convertirea audio
Pentru a extrage audio din fișierele media, parametrul liniei de comandă -x trebuie să fie trecut. De asemenea, este posibil să alegeți formatul audio extras, cu parametrul –Audio-Formatnull